Belmont -/* - Cristaltec "Game Cristal" (MAME bootleg) - - Skeleton driver by R. Belmont, based on taitowlf.c by Ville Linde - - Note: - - bp 000F16B5 do bx=0x16bb (can't skip this check?) - - Specs: P3-866, SiS 630 graphics card, SiS 7018 sound, Windows 98, DirectX 8.1. - - Input is via a custom COM1 port JAMMA adaptor. - - The custom emulator is a heavily modified version of MAME32. If you extract the - disk image, it's in C:\GH4\GH4.EXE. It's UPX compressed, so unpack it before doing - any forensics. The emulator does run on Windows as new as XP Pro SP2 but you can't - control it due to the lack of the custom input. - - Updates 27/11/2007 (Diego Nappino): - The COM1 port is opened at 19200 bps, No parity, 8 bit data,1 stop bit. - The protocol is based on a 6 bytes frame with a leading byte valued 0x05 and a trailing one at 0x02 - The four middle bytes are used, in negative logic (0xFF = No button pressed), to implement the inputs. - Each bit meaning as follows : - - Byte 1 Byte 2 Byte 3 Byte 4 - Bit 0 P1-Credit P1-Button C P2-Left UNUSED - Bit 1 P1-Start P1-Button D P2-Right UNUSED - Bit 2 P1-Down P1-Button E P2-Button A SERVICE - Bit 3 P1-Up TEST P2-Button B UNUSED - Bit 4 P1-Left P2-Credit P2-Button C UNUSED - Bit 5 P1-Right P2-Start P2-Button D UNUSED - Bit 6 P1-Button A P2-Down P2-Button E UNUSED - Bit 7 P1-Button B P2-Up VIDEO-MODE UNUSED - - The JAMMA adaptor sends a byte frame each time an input changes.
